FRENCH ONION RICE (RICE COOKER)
I adapted this from a bag of Publix supermarket brand Extra Long Grain rice. I love it because it has 4 ingredients but has so much flavor. It's wonderful to use to sop up broth or gravy from entrees...
Provided by saTory
Categories Long Grain Rice
Time 1h
Yield 3 cups, 4-6 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 4
Steps:
- Wash the cup of rice thoroughly - five times should do it to get the water clear. Don't skip this step! (Note: use a regular English measuring cup, not the plastic cup that comes with your rice cooker).
- Put the rice and the soups in the rice cooker. Float the butter on top. Close the cooker. If using a fuzzy logic cooker press the regular rice menu option and start, or just press ON if using a kettle style cooker. It should take anywhere from 55 minutes to an hour to complete.

RICE COOKER BACON AND ONION RICE
This rich rice dish can be made in a rice cooker, my favorite, or a regular pot. It goes well with red meat, such as stew or steak.
Provided by strawberrybird
Categories White Rice
Time 20m
Yield 3/4 cup, 4 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 4
Steps:
- Cut onion into chunks (approx. about 1/2").
- Slice bacon into small pieces (approx. 1/4" square).
- Place rice in rice cooker and add water as recommended (usually about 2 cups). Set to cook.
- Heat medium-sized frying pan over medium heat. Fry bacon and onion together until bacon is crisp.
- When rice is done, add butter or margarine and stir to combine. Add bacon and onion mixture and stir to combine.

FRENCH ONION, RICE AND VEGETABLE CASSEROLE
I needed to keep the pantry rotating, and wanted a new and different side for roast chicken. Tasty, though... my husband and I like to spice things up a bit, others may want to tone down the seasonings by half to start, then work up towards the full amount to suit your palate.
Provided by GirlFreitag
Categories Brown Rice
Time 1h55m
Yield 8 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 14
Steps:
- Combine soup, water and rice in pan, bring to boil, stir once. Cover, reduce heat and simmer 45 minutes. Stir to mix; pull off heat and let set for 15 minutes.
- Meanwhile, combine all canned vegetables in a bowl to mix evenly, set aside.
- Combine yogurt and spices until well mixed, fold into rice until well distributed.
- In a 9 x 13" baking dish layer ½ of the vegetable mixture, then ½ the rice mixture followed by ½ the cheese. Repeat 1st two layers. Evenly intersperse French fried onions for next layer, top with remaining cheese.
- If you made this ahead of time and it is just coming out of the refrigerator, place in a cold oven and bake for 45 min at 475 degrees. Otherwise it might be bubbly and done after 30 minutes or so.
